Generally, campgrounds provide varying levels of services. Basic campgrounds might offer only designated campsites, fire rings, and perhaps pit toilets. More developed campgrounds could include flush toilets, showers, potable water sources, picnic tables, and even RV hookups (water, electricity, sewer). Backcountry or primitive campgrounds, often accessible by trails, might have minimal to no services provided.
